1. Sony WH-1000XM6 – The New Standard for Noise Cancelling Headphones
Sony continues to dominate the wireless headphone market with the WH-1000XM6, a model that pushes noise cancellation and sound quality to a new level. Powered by the HD Noise Canceling Processor QN3, which is significantly faster than the previous generation, these headphones use twelve microphones to monitor and cancel external noise in real time. The result is an incredibly immersive listening experience that eliminates distractions whether you’re traveling, working, or relaxing.
What truly sets the WH-1000XM6 apart is its collaboration with mastering audio engineers. This results in studio-quality sound that remains faithful to the original recording. The specially designed driver with a lightweight carbon fiber dome ensures rich vocals, balanced mids, and crisp highs, making these headphones ideal for music enthusiasts and content creators alike.
Sony’s Adaptive NC Optimizer intelligently adjusts to environmental noise, air pressure, and even how the headphones are worn, ensuring consistent performance in any situation. The Auto Ambient Sound mode adds flexibility by allowing important sounds like announcements or conversations to come through when needed. With support for High-Resolution Audio and LDAC, users get significantly higher data transmission compared to standard Bluetooth audio, delivering a premium listening experience.
Add in up to 30 hours of battery life, quick charging that provides hours of playback in minutes, a foldable design, and AI-powered call clarity, and the WH-1000XM6 stands as the most complete wireless headphone option in 2026.
2. Apple AirPods Max – Seamless Integration Meets Immersive Sound
Apple’s AirPods Max continues to be one of the most polished wireless headphones available, especially for users within the Apple ecosystem. Designed around computational audio, these headphones combine hardware and software to deliver a refined and immersive listening experience.
The custom dynamic driver produces high-fidelity sound, while the Apple H1 chip enables real-time processing for features like Active Noise Cancellation and Transparency Mode. One of the standout features is Personalized Spatial Audio with dynamic head tracking, which creates a surround-sound effect that places audio around you, making movies and music feel more immersive.
Comfort is another key strength, with memory foam ear cushions and a breathable knit mesh canopy that distributes weight evenly across the head. The user experience is seamless, offering instant pairing, automatic switching between Apple devices, and intuitive control through the Digital Crown.
Although the battery life is around 20 hours, the combination of premium build quality, immersive audio, and effortless usability makes the AirPods Max a top choice for users who prioritize convenience and ecosystem integration.
3. Jabra Evolve3 85 – The Ultimate Work and Call Headset
The Jabra Evolve3 85 is designed for a completely different purpose compared to most wireless headphones on this list. Instead of focusing purely on music, it prioritizes communication, productivity, and clarity for professionals working in busy environments.
Equipped with six intelligent microphones and AI-based voice isolation technology, these headphones ensure that your voice is always clear, even in noisy surroundings. This makes them one of the best wireless headphones for video calls, remote work, and business use in 2026.
Adaptive noise cancellation helps block distractions, allowing you to stay focused whether you’re at home, in the office, or traveling. The enhanced spatial sound feature makes conversations feel more natural and less fatiguing during long meetings.
Battery performance is where the Evolve3 85 truly stands out, offering up to 120 hours of music playback and fast charging that provides hours of use in just minutes. Combined with a lightweight, foldable design and sleek appearance, these headphones are built for professionals who need reliability and comfort throughout the day.
4. Bowers & Wilkins Px7 S3 – Premium Sound for Audiophiles
The Bowers & Wilkins Px7 S3 represents the luxury segment of wireless headphones, delivering a listening experience that focuses heavily on sound quality, detail, and craftsmanship. These headphones are designed for users who want wireless convenience without sacrificing audio fidelity.
Featuring custom-tuned 40 mm bio-cellulose drivers and a 24-bit digital signal processor, the Px7 S3 produces a rich, natural sound that remains true to the original recording. This makes them ideal for listeners who appreciate depth, clarity, and balance across all genres of music.
The active noise cancellation system adapts to your surroundings, reducing unwanted noise while preserving audio detail. With eight microphones strategically placed, these headphones also provide excellent call quality by isolating your voice from background noise.
The design combines premium materials with long-lasting comfort, including memory foam ear cushions and an ergonomically designed headband. With up to 30 hours of battery life and fast charging capabilities, the Px7 S3 offers both performance and convenience in a high-end package.
5. Bose QuietComfort Ultra (2nd Gen) – The Most Immersive Listening Experience
Bose has built its reputation on delivering some of the best noise cancelling headphones in the world, and the QuietComfort Ultra (2nd Gen) continues that legacy. These headphones are designed to create an immersive listening environment where outside noise disappears completely.
Bose’s advanced noise cancellation system offers multiple modes, including Quiet Mode, Aware Mode, and Immersion Mode, allowing users to tailor their listening experience. The standout feature is spatial audio, which places sound in front of you rather than inside your head, creating a more natural and engaging experience.
Cinema Mode enhances video content by balancing sound effects and dialogue, making these headphones ideal for watching movies or streaming content. The built-in microphones use AI-based noise suppression to ensure clear communication during calls and video conferencing.
With up to 30 hours of battery life, a comfortable design featuring plush ear cushions, and Bluetooth 5.4 connectivity, the QuietComfort Ultra is perfect for users who prioritize comfort, immersion, and silence.
6. JBL Tune 770NC – Best Value with Massive Battery Life
The JBL Tune 770NC is proof that you don’t need to spend premium prices to get a solid pair of wireless noise cancelling headphones. Designed for everyday use, these headphones focus on delivering long battery life, reliable performance, and strong sound quality.
One of the standout features is the impressive 70-hour battery life, making it one of the longest-lasting wireless headphones in 2026. Even when the battery runs low, a quick five-minute charge provides several hours of playback, making it perfect for users on the go.
Adaptive Noise Cancelling helps reduce distractions, while Smart Ambient features like TalkThru and Ambient Aware allow you to stay aware of your surroundings when needed. JBL’s signature Pure Bass Sound delivers a punchy and energetic audio profile that works well for modern music genres.
With Bluetooth 5.3 connectivity, multi-device pairing, and a lightweight, foldable design, the JBL Tune 770NC offers excellent value for users who want dependable wireless headphones without breaking the bank.
